Dante, Virginia Climate Data

Dante, Virginia has a Humid Subtropical Climate climate (Köppen classification: Cfa). Average annual temperatures range from 6.2 °C (low) to 19 °C (high). Annual precipitation averages 1225.6 Millimeters. Dante is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 7a.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Apr. 21 - Apr. 30 through the first frost around Oct. 11 - Oct. 20.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Dante, Virginia

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Fahrenheit
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January-4.5 °C6.6 °C96.01 mm
February-3.1 °C8.7 °C93.73 mm
March0.4 °C13.6 °C112.01 mm
April5.2 °C20 °C108.71 mm
May10.3 °C24.1 °C117.09 mm
June15.1 °C27.8 °C129.54 mm
July17.1 °C29.2 °C132.08 mm
August16.4 °C28.8 °C102.11 mm
September12.8 °C26.3 °C86.87 mm
October6.1 °C20.5 °C68.58 mm
November0.4 °C13.7 °C74.68 mm
December-2.4 °C8.6 °C104.14 mm
Annual6.2 °C19 °C1225.55 mm
